Meaning & usage

adj/lɛˈɲi.vɘ/
  1. lazy, sluggish (unwilling to work)

  2. lazy, sluggish (slow)

  3. lazy, sluggish (unhurried)

Where this word comes from

Etymology tree Proto-Slavic *lěnь Proto-Slavic *-ivъ Proto-Slavic *lěnivъ Polish leniwy Inherited from Proto-Slavic *lěnivъ. By surface analysis, leń + -iwy.
